Embrace the journey of self-improvement: Even the most successful people face challenges and setbacks, but maintaining a positive attitude and continuing to learn from experiences is key to growth.
No matter how difficult the journey may seem, it's important to focus on the positive and continue working on self-improvement. The speaker shares his experience as a comedian, where not every performance was successful, but he learned to search for the good and use each experience to improve. He emphasizes that everyone will face rejection and self-doubt at some point, but it's crucial to hold on to the belief that there's always something good to be taken away from each situation. The speaker also mentions the influence of Michael Jordan's documentary, "The Last Dance," and Steve Kerr's journey to eight championships, highlighting that even the most successful people encounter challenges and setbacks along the way. Overall, the key takeaway is to maintain a positive attitude and keep pushing forward, even when faced with adversity.
Believing in yourself and focusing on improving is key to comedy success: To succeed in comedy, believe in yourself, focus on improving, and climb the many small hills to mastering joke-telling and performance.
Success in comedy, or any creative field, requires unwavering dedication and a clear vision. The speaker emphasized the importance of believing in oneself and focusing on improving the craft, even when faced with setbacks and criticism. He also highlighted the potential financial rewards in comedy and the various opportunities it presents, such as hosting jobs and talk shows. However, getting there requires climbing numerous small hills, from learning how to be a good comedian to building an audience and marketing oneself. The speaker acknowledged that becoming a great comedian is the hardest part, as it requires mastering the art of joke-telling and performance. Overall, the journey to success in comedy is challenging, but with determination and a clear vision, it can lead to significant rewards.

Learning from past mistakes in relationships: Understanding the impact of actions, preparing for challenges, and maintaining a strong internal bond are crucial for personal growth in relationships.
Experience and learning from past mistakes are essential for personal growth, especially in relationships. The speaker acknowledges that he didn't fully understand the impact of his actions on others in his younger years and had a dismissive attitude towards challenges. However, through experiencing hardships and gaining new knowledge, he has come to appreciate the importance of being prepared for future challenges and being supportive of his wife during difficult times. The speaker admires his wife's strength and clarity in distinguishing reality from false reality, and credits her for setting a tone of resilience and accountability in their relationship. The biggest lesson he has learned from her is the importance of not letting external negativity affect the internal bond of a relationship.
